Philz Coffee is ushering in the spring season with the debut of two new specialty drinks--Nutty Caramel Nirvana and Caramel Cardamom Karma--available from March 25 through June 2 (while supplies last).
Crafted with Philz’s signature cold brew, all-natural caramel, and plant-based milk, these indulgent new offerings can be enjoyed iced or hot, fully customizable to suit every taste—especially tailored for Generation Z. Notably, this marks the first time Philz has introduced caramel to its menu.
- Nutty Caramel Nirvana blends Philtered Soul Cold Brew with real cinnamon, creamy almond milk, and all-natural caramel, topped with a delicate dusting of cinnamon sugar.
- Caramel Cardamom Karma features Mission Cold Brew, house-made caramel oat milk infused with cardamom, and a finishing touch of caramel drizzle and Maldon sea salt for a sweet-savory balance.

The new spring offerings are available at all 70+ Philz Coffee locations across California and Chicago. Founded in 2003by Phil Jaber and his son Jacob in San Francisco, Philz Coffee is renowned for its handcrafted, customized blends—roasted in-house at its Oakland facility. Today, the brand continues to serve its signature pour-over coffee and creative beverages across the San Francisco Bay Area, Los Angeles, San Diego, Sacramento, and Chicago.
